The FCI Targeted Testing (FCIT) algorithm implements a search algorithm for learning the structure of a graphical
model from observational data with latent variables. The algorithm uses the BOSS or GRaSP algorithm to get an initial
CPDAG. Then it uses scoring steps to infer some unshielded colliders in the graph, then finishes with a testing step
to remove extra edges and orient more unshielded colliders. Finally, the final FCI orientation is applied to the
graph.

setVerbose
public void setVerbose(boolean verbose) True, just in case good and restored changes are printed. The algorithm always moves to a legal PAG; if it doesn't, it is restored to the previous PAG, and a "restored" message is printed. Otherwise, a "good" message is printed.- Parameters:
verbose- True if changes to the graph should be printed.

setCheckAdjacencySepsets
public void setCheckAdjacencySepsets(boolean checkAdjacencySepsets) True if condition sets should at the end be checked that are subsets of adjacents of the variables. This is only done after all recursive sepset removals have been done. True by default. This is needed in order to pass an Oracle test but can reduce accuracy from data.- Parameters:
checkAdjacencySepsets- True if the final FCI-style rule of checking adjacency sepsets should be performed.
